You asked, how do you trim music on GarageBand?

  1. In GarageBand on Mac, place the pointer over the lower-left or lower-right edge of the region. The pointer changes to a Trim pointer.
  2. Drag the pointer over the part you want to trim. As you drag, the help tag shows the region length and the amount by which it’s trimmed.

Furthermore, how do I edit an audio recording on a Mac? In the Voice Memos app on your Mac, select the recording in the sidebar. Click the Edit button in the upper-right corner to open the recording in the Edit window. If you have a trackpad or a Magic Mouse, click or tap with two fingers on the recording in the sidebar, then choose Edit Recording.

Considering this, where is audio editor in GarageBand? In GarageBand on Mac, do one of the following: Select an audio track in the Tracks area, then click the Editors button . Select an audio track in the Tracks area, then choose View > Show Editors. Double-click an audio region to open it in the Audio Editor.

How do you import songs into GarageBand on a Mac?

  1. 1) Click File from the menu bar and put your cursor over iCloud.
  2. 2) Select either Import GarageBand for iOS or Import Music Memos File in the pop-out menu.
  3. 3) Browse for your item, select it, and click Open for the iOS song or Import for the Music Memos file.

How do you import a song into GarageBand?

  1. Click on Finder in the Mac Dock.
  2. Locate the file that you wish to import. Click and drag the file onto an existing track or a new track in GarageBand. GarageBand supports the following formats: .AIFF, .CAF, .WAV, .AAC (except protected AAC files), Apple Lossless, .MP3, .MIDI.

How do I edit a WAV file on a Mac?

  1. Open the file in QuickTime Player.
  2. Choose Edit > Trim. The trimming bar appears.
  3. To select the portion of the recording you want to keep, drag the yellow trimming bar handles to the left and right as desired.
  4. When you are satisfied with your selection area, click Trim.
